0第二部分新型自动气象站的系统结构与原理2、新型自动气象站的系统结构与原理2.1、新型自动气象站应用到的新技术在新型自动气象站中应到了两项比较新的技术,即:嵌入式系统技术和外部现场总线技术
2.1.1、嵌入式系统技术嵌入式系统是以高性能CPU数据处理器为核心处理器,嵌入操作系统,配置相关的外围组件,构成单板电脑系统
高性能的CPU一般是指32位CPU,包括:ARM7系列、ARM9系列以及现在比较新的ARMCortexM3系列或其他系列CPU等
操作系统嵌入实时性比较好的操作系统,一般可以嵌入:μC/OS-II、FreeRTOS、μClinux等
以上操作系统的特点是:实时性比较好,规模相对比较小,所需要的硬件资源也不大
但功能相对简单一点
对于功能要求比较多的可以选用Linux操作系统或WindowCE操作系统
其特点是:功能比较齐全,基本上具备标准电脑的全部功能,所构成的系统又称单板电脑
Linux操作系统是开源的可以从网络上找到;WindowCE在使用时是需要付版权费用的
外围部件配置基本上按照标准电脑的部件配置,包括:Flash存储器、RAM存储器、CF卡(或SD卡)存储器、以太网络接口电路以及TCP/IP通讯协议、USB通讯端口、多个RS232/RS485串口、CAN总线
图一、嵌入式系统基本结构图嵌入式系统的数据综合处理能力非常强大,在新型自动站系统中引入了嵌入式系统,可以大大提高自动气象站的数据处理能力,使很多复杂的数据分析、处理计算功能在数据采集器端得以实现
嵌入式系统丰富的外设处理单元、多种通讯端口,可以非常方便地实时自动气象站的数据通讯处理、远程访问的功能
2.1.2、外部总线技术外部总线是用来连接各个数据处理控制、数据处理单元,并完成数据传输、通讯处理功
1外部总线的功能就是实现多个数据处理控制、数据处理单元之间的数据通讯;外部总线的的电气结构要求简单,